The Hopelink organization offers a Family Development Program aimed at homeless families and individuals, guiding them towards self-sufficiency and stability. The program provides families with a case manager who helps to create a self-sufficiency plan, tailored to their unique needs and circumstances. This plan focuses on housing stability, employment, financial management, education, health, and social networks. Hopelink's goal is to assist families in escaping the cycle of poverty and homelessness, and moving towards a more stable and independent lifestyle.
